    Key Ingredients in Rolling Thai

    When it comes to rolling thai, the ingredients are just as important as the technique. Fresh, high-quality ingredients are the foundation of every great dish. Here are some of the most commonly used ingredients in rolling thai:

    • Rice paper – the perfect wrap for spring rolls and other rolled dishes.
    • Herbs like cilantro, mint, and basil – these add a fresh, aromatic touch to your rolls.
    • Proteins such as shrimp, chicken, or tofu – depending on your preference, you can choose from a variety of proteins.
    • Noodles – rice noodles or glass noodles are often used as a base for fillings.
    • Sauces – from sweet chili sauce to peanut sauce, these add an extra layer of flavor to your rolls.

    Remember, the key to great rolling thai is using fresh, seasonal ingredients. Don’t be afraid to experiment with different combinations to find what works best for you.

    Step-by-Step Guide to Rolling

    Here’s a simple step-by-step guide to rolling thai:

    1. Place your rice paper on a flat surface.
    2. Add your fillings in the center of the rice paper, leaving some space around the edges.
    3. Fold the bottom edge over the fillings, then fold in the sides.
    4. Roll the wrap tightly, making sure everything stays in place.

    And that’s it! With a little practice, you’ll be able to roll perfect thai rolls every time. Remember, practice makes perfect, so don’t get discouraged if your first few attempts don’t turn out exactly as you’d hoped.

    Delicious Rolling Thai Recipes

    Now that you’ve got the basics down, let’s dive into some delicious rolling thai recipes. Here are a few of our favorites:

    1. Spring Rolls with Sweet Chili Sauce

    This classic recipe is a must-try for anyone new to rolling thai. Start by preparing your fillings – cooked shrimp, fresh herbs, and rice noodles work perfectly. Once your rice paper is softened, add your fillings and roll according to the technique we discussed earlier. Serve with a side of sweet chili sauce for dipping, and enjoy!

    2. Vegetarian Thai Rolls

    If you’re looking for a vegetarian option, these rolls are a great choice. Use ingredients like tofu, avocado, and fresh vegetables to create a flavorful and satisfying dish. Top it off with a peanut sauce for an extra burst of flavor.

    Essential Tools for Rolling Thai

    Having the right tools can make all the difference when it comes to rolling thai. Here are a few essentials you’ll want to have on hand:

    • A flat surface for rolling – a clean cutting board or plate works well.
    • A bowl of warm water – for softening the rice paper.
    • Tongs or chopsticks – for handling delicate ingredients.
    • A sharp knife – for cutting ingredients into thin strips or slices.

    Investing in quality tools will make the rolling process smoother and more enjoyable. Plus, it’ll make your rolls look even more professional.
